A 16-year-old boy from Nottingham has been charged with a terrorism offence.
The boy was arrested by officers from Counter Terrorism Policing East Midlands (CTPEM), on Friday 11 September/
He has since been charged with engaging in conduct in preparation to commit terrorist acts, contrary to section 5 of the Terrorism Act 2006.
Senior investigating officer Detective Inspector Steve Shaw from CTPEM said: “I understand that this arrest and charge may cause concern, but please be reassured we will continue to work with Nottinghamshire Police and partners to act on any information that indicates a potential threat.
“The safety of our communities is our number one priority and public support is vital to our mission to keep people safe.
